Pop calendar issues
Pop up calendar not is same format as main calendar display on homepage.
TWTFSSM instead of MTWTFSS.
Showing incorrect day for date. 1st Oct 2008 shown as Thusday should be Wednesday

Inappropriate?you can also use MD build 622 as the described bug was solved;
from changelog:
621: Fixed problem with incorrect offset of day headers in French and other week-starts-on-monday locales
